The coating on a plate 2 m in diameter is cured by placing it symmetrically below an electrically heated plate also 2 m in diameter. The emissivity of the heater is 0.7 and that of the coating is 0.4 and both surfaces can be considered to be grey. During the curing process the temperature of the heater and the coatings are 1100 K and 550 K respectively, and the assembly is exposed to black surroundings at 295 K. The top of the heater and the under-side of the plate are insulated. (a) Calculate the electrical power input to the heater if the plates are separated by 0.4 m. (b) Determine also the net rate of heat transfer to the coated plate. Convective heat transfer can be neglected.
